XPander Heat Detector and Mounting Base

There are two heat detectors in the XPander range designed to suit a wide variety of operating conditions. A static heat detector (CS) which responds only when a fixed temperature has been reached and a rate-of-rise detector (A1R) which has a fixed upper limit, but in addition, measures the rate of increase in temperature.

XPander Interface Unit

The XPander Interface Unit communicates between the intelligent control panel and the XPander detectors as the detectors alone can't communicate directly with the panel.
